Cyclothymic Depression

Cyclothymic is a caused by dramatic mood changes. It is considered to be a form of bipolar II disorder where the patient will at one moment feel highly irritable and then fall into a state of depression. Some symptoms of this are, as mentioned above, the person drifts between a highly irritable mood and more energy, and then they will usually fall into a period of depression. The period of is where the person will suffer constant mood swings, sadness, have changes in sleep patterns and eating habits, worthlessness, and fatigue. The person may also appear to slow down in thinking and response. The period where the person will have more energy will exhibit signs of irritability, appear to be more hyper in speech and in their activities and appear to have more focus on their activities than before.

What causes cyclothymic is not yet entirely understood; however, research has shown it to be a mood disorder that could be a result of the genes a person may inherit. As is true with many types of depression, there is still a lot of research being done on to find out more about it. Even though some people might be suffering the same type of depression, their symptoms differ as well as their treatments. The causes of also tend to differ from person to person.

Despite the fact that is not yet fully understood, more is being found out about every day through the research that is being done. New treatments and therapies are being developed for patients all the time and many people are being successfully treated by these methods.
